Tasting 2007 d'Arenberg The Stump Jump

stumpjump.jpg

  • 2007 d'Arenberg The Stump Jump - Australia, South Australia, Fleurieu, McLaren Vale (12/26/2009)
    Peachy with honeysuckle blossom, ripe honeydew. Hint of oily petrol aroma. Finishes sweet. Quite nice. Off an "expensive" restaurant wine list in Vietnam it was $30 so if it is available retail in the US, it should be at an attractive price to stock up: it would go well either as a sipping wine at a party or with Asian fare. (85 pts.)
